Preventive Health and Health Services Block Grant
Funding by Health Program Areas FY 2006

Block Funding to Public Health Programs
- Chronic Diseases: $35,021,021
- Infrastructure: $13,834,409
- Access to Health Care: $10,188,528
- Other Programs: $8,583,231
- Sex Offense: $7,534,024
- Injury: $6,427,270
- Immunizations/Infectious Diseases: $4,884,094
- Total Block Grant Funding to All Public Health Programs:
$86,473,375.
Block Funding to Chronic Disease Programs
- Education/Community Based Programs: $13,666,541
- Heart Disease & Stroke: $7,983,112
- Physical Fitness: $4,730,345
- Oral Health/Fluoridation: $2,829,025
- Nutrition/Overweight: $2,693,353
- Diabetes: $1,747,813
- Cancer: $1,252,648
- Arthritis: $118,004
- Total Block Grant Funding to Chronic Disease Programs: $35,021,021.
